Here are some steps and tips to get you started:

1. Gather the right tools: To begin your painting journey, you'll need a few essential tools. Invest in a set of high-quality brushes with different sizes and shapes, as they will greatly impact the quality of your painting. Additionally, you'll need paints specifically designed for miniatures, a palette, water container, and a primer to prepare the surface of your figures.

2. Start with a primer: Before painting, it's important to prime your miniatures. Priming creates a smooth surface for the paint to adhere to and helps bring out the details of the figure. Use a spray primer or brush-on primer in a color that suits your desired final look.

3. Practice basic techniques: Begin by practicing basic techniques such as base coating, shading, and highlighting. Base coating involves applying the main colors to your figures, while shading and highlighting add depth and dimension. There are many tutorials and guides available online that can help you learn these techniques step by step.

4. Take your time: Painting miniatures is a meticulous process that requires patience. Take your time and work on one area at a time. Start with the larger areas and gradually move to the smaller details. Remember, it's okay to make mistakes. You can always correct them or start over if needed.

5. Experiment and have fun: Don't be afraid to experiment with different painting styles and techniques. Miniature painting is a creative outlet, and you can develop your own unique style over time. Try different color schemes, weathering effects, or even freehand designs to make your miniatures stand out.

6. Learn from others: Joining a community of miniature painters can be incredibly helpful. Online forums, social media groups, and local hobby stores often have communities of painters who are willing to share their knowledge and provide feedback on your work. Learning from others and seeing their techniques can inspire you and help you improve your skills.
